IN RE LINDSAY

No. 2985.

12 F.Supp. 625 (1935)

In re LINDSAY.

District Court, N. D. Iowa, W. D.

November 27, 1935.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Lew McDonald, of Cherokee, Iowa, for debtor.

Stewart & Hatfield, of Sioux City, Iowa, for mortgagee.


SCOTT, District Judge.

The controversy here presented is between a farmer debtor under section 75 of the Bankruptcy Act, as amended by the Act approved August 28, 1935, commonly referred to as the second Frazier-Lemke Act (11 USCA § 203 (g, k, n, p, and s), and the holder of a mortgage in course of foreclosure on the debtor's farm.
